WebMay 21, 2014 · Breadcrumbs are a user interface element designed to make navigation easy and intuitive. They are used by operating systems , software programs, and websites . Breadcrumbs display the directory path of the current folder or webpage and provide one-click access to each of the parent directories . WebOct 24, 2024 · A breadcrumb bar lets a user keep track of their location when navigating through an app or folders, and lets them quickly jump back to a previous location in the path. Use a BreadcrumbBar when the path taken to the current position is relevant.
